BoMill AB (BOMILL) — Net Asset Quality Index
BoMill AB (BOMILL) has a Net Asset Quality Index of 40.5% as of March 2026. This metric measures the proportion of total assets financed by shareholders' equity — total assets of Skr30.93 Million minus total liabilities of Skr18.41 Million yields net assets of Skr12.52 Million. Annual Net Asset Quality Index for BoMill AB (2018–2025)
The table below presents the year-by-year Net Asset Quality Index for BoMill AB from 2018 to 2025, covering 8 annual filings. Each row shows total assets, total liabilities, net assets, the quality index perc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. | Year | Quality Index | Net Assets (SEK) | Total Assets | Total Liabilities | Change (pp)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 51.8% | Skr14.11 Million | Skr27.24 Million | Skr13.13 Million | ▼ -4.4 pp |
| 2024 | 56.2% | Skr20.70 Million | Skr36.85 Million | Skr16.15 Million | ▼ -20.0 pp |
| 2023 | 76.2% | Skr21.45 Million | Skr28.14 Million | Skr6.70 Million | ▼ -0.3 pp |
| 2022 | 76.5% | Skr18.92 Million | Skr24.73 Million | Skr5.81 Million | ▼ -12.4 pp |
| 2021 | 88.9% | Skr22.84 Million | Skr25.70 Million | Skr2.85 Million | ▲ +4.7 pp |
| 2020 | 84.2% | Skr31.98 Million | Skr37.98 Million | Skr6.00 Million | ▲ +22.0 pp |
| 2019 | 62.2% | Skr13.72 Million | Skr22.04 Million | Skr8.32 Million | ▲ +38.0 pp |
| 2018 | 24.3% | Skr5.97 Million | Skr24.62 Million | Skr18.65 Million | — |
